Output 531434de448920343153adc93090ea5520320b441c2e6af90cb8d1770c5a3df8:0

value
627974
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40fc550ceeda64df286825b40ffba3f811b1e440 OP_EQUALVERIFY OP_CHECKSIG
address
16vcXdQkzEFifa9EPMnxe8pwSD6NddBkM5
transaction
531434de448920343153adc93090ea5520320b441c2e6af90cb8d1770c5a3df8
spent
true